UPVC Window Repairs

Upvc windows are able to reduce heating costs and are energy efficient. However, as they get older, issues can develop that require repair. This can be due to damaged handles, hinges or locks.

DIY enthusiasts can fix wooden windows with ease. It can also be much cheaper than buying a new window.

Cracks

Cracks and fractures in uPVC windows can be a major issue. If they are not fixed, they could cause water infiltration, less effective protection against cold temperatures and the potential for structural damage. It is important to find an expert local builder or repair service that specializes in repairing uPVC frames and can demonstrate the experience, skills and equipment required to achieve the most effective results. This will ensure your crack is repaired swiftly before it gets worse, and you won't have to replace your window unit or glass.

Small cracks in glass can be fixed with a range of home-based solutions. Masking tape and super glue are among the most common products that can hold broken glass in place for a time. For cracks that are more extensive, tape may need be extended on both sides.

Alternatively, two-part epoxy can be used to fix broken or cracked glass. Most hardware stores offer this product at around $10. Make sure your workspace is prepped before mixing the epoxy and make sure you have the correct tool for the job for example, a soldering tool.

If your lower or upper sash is difficult to raise it's because the cords on the sash's weights have been damaged. Fortunately, this is an easy fix that can be made with the help of the ladder and a flat-head screwdriver. Replacing a rotted drip cap is another simple repair that can be completed at home. Many home centers stock a drip caps that are not rot free and can be easily caulked or nailed to be fixed. If you have a double or triple-pane window, be certain to ensure that one of the panes are not broken. The reason is because the gases in the space between the windows are responsible for increasing the energy efficiency of the window. They should not be allowed to escape.

Water Leaks

If your uPVC windows are leaking, it could damage the interior of your home and result in costly repairs. Water leaks can also damage the structure of your house and lead to the growth of mold. It is important to fix any issues caused by leaky windows as soon as possible to limit the damage.

A damaged sealant around window frames is a common cause of leaks. Utilizing silicone caulk can help restore the condition of the seal back to normal and stop water leakage. Examine for gaps and cracks around the window frame, as well as the brick or stone wall that surrounds your windows.

A blocked drainage hole or defective flashing are the other two typical causes of windows leaking. It's crucial to make sure the drainage holes are clear and free of obstruction, particularly after a heavy rainstorm. It's also a good idea to inspect the flashing that runs around the top of your window and ensure it's sealed correctly.

It's also crucial to ensure that your drip cap doesn't have any decay or is missing. A rotted or damaged drip cap can allow water to enter the window from above, causing damage to your home's structure. Replacing drip caps isn't an arduous task and usually a straightforward process of buying the new one and putting it in the correct position.

A professional can also test your windows for watertightness. They can utilize a special instrument to test the water-tightness of your windows to make sure they are in line with industry standards. If your windows don't pass the test, you will need to replace them. This is a costly repair, but it's worth it for the comfort and safety of your family.

Broken Hinges

If your uPVC window hinges are damaged or are not functioning correctly and you are unable to open or close the window, it will be difficult to open or close the window. This could be a security problem and also prevent your home from staying warm or cold. You can easily get a new hinge for your upvc window repairs window. It's crucial to choose the right type for your windows.

Replacement-Windows-150x150.jpgThe hinges need to be the same size to fit into the window frame. The most commonly used hinge used in Upvc windows is an 15mm or 18mm UPVC window hinge. There are also specialised hinges for wooden frames. Getting the correct type of window hinge for your windows can aid in avoiding typical issues that homeowners have with their windows, for example, not closing properly.

There are several reasons why your window hinges could be loose or stiff. One of the most common causes is that the hinges aren't tightened enough. You can check this by using a screwdriver to locate the friction screw that is at the end of the hinge, and then loosen it. Then, you can adjust it by turning it either way.

Locks that aren't working

UPVC window mechanisms and locks are an important component of home security. They make it difficult to open windows without breaking into the home. It can be a hassle when a lock fails, but you don't have to replace the entire window.

Often the problem can be an issue that could have been prevented by regular maintenance. This is why we suggest getting your uPVC windows maintained regularly using our yearly maintenance package to minimize the risk of issues.

Modern uPVC windows have espagnolette locks that work by pushing the nose of the handle across a wedge block then turning the handle to close the lock. They are effective in locking the window, however when they are not maintained in a timely manner, they could begin to fail. We recommend applying WD-40 to them a couple of times a year.

If you notice that your uPVC windows aren't opening and shut as quickly as they used to, or If the lock isn't functioning properly, it's likely that there is an issue with the locking gearbox within the window frame. This can be difficult to access because it requires the removal of the seals that surround the frame of the window, and taking off the handle.

A locksmith that specializes in UPVC repairs will have the expertise to diagnose this fault quickly and be able replace the gearbox that failed to lock with a precise replacement. This is a quick and easy repair that can save you hundreds of pounds by avoiding the need to buy new windows.
